Pharma Platforms : Satisfying the Administration and GMP Regulations
Ensuring product integrity throughout the distribution network is critical for pharmaceutical companies. This necessitates the use of compliant pallets – often referred to as pharmaceutical pallets – that strictly adhere to both the FDA’s regulations and GMP requirements. These pallets must be constructed from approved materials, usually metal, which are devoid of contaminants and designed to avoid adulteration. Proper pallet design also considers factors like arranging stability, dampness resistance, and ease of cleaning and sterilization. Periodic inspections and tracking are mandatory to confirm ongoing adherence and preserve pharmaceutical quality.
Here's a short overview of key considerations:
- Material Choice : Must be compliant and inert to eliminate interactions with the pharmaceutical product.
- Tracking : Pallets should have a distinct tracking system for full oversight throughout the supply chain .
- Cleaning Methods : Validated procedures must be in effect to confirm the elimination of any potential impurities .
- Preservation Requirements : Pallets must be stored in regulated environments to protect product stability.
